Preparing for Surgical procedure



Before your cataract surgical procedure, it is very important to on a regular basis follow the guidelines offered by your doctor.

Among the most vital action in planning for surgical procedure is to stop taking any type of drugs that may hinder the procedure. Your doctor will supply you with a checklist of medicines to stay clear of, such as blood thinners or aspirin.

Furthermore, you need to schedule a person to drive you to and from the surgery center, as you won't be able to drive immediately after the procedure.




It's additionally crucial to fast for a certain time period prior to the surgical treatment to guarantee your stomach is vacant. Your doctor will provide certain instructions regarding the fasting period.

Long-Term Recuperation Tips



Throughout the long-term recovery period, you should continue to follow your doctor's guidelines to make certain an effective healing process after cataract surgical procedure. It is essential to take any recommended medicines as directed, such as eye decreases or oral drugs, to avoid infection and promote healing.

You need to also avoid any type of laborious activities, such as heavy training or bending over, for the initial couple of weeks after surgical procedure to prevent any type of complications. It's advised to use sunglasses when going outside to safeguard your eyes from bright sunshine or rough wind.

Ensure to go to all scheduled follow-up visits with your doctor to check your development and deal with any issues. Bear in mind to be individual and offer on your own time to fully recuperate, as it might take a few weeks or months for your vision to maintain.
